Connecting alfaview
Create alfaview meetings for your bookings automatically
alfaview is a GDPR-compliant video conferencing solution made in Stuttgart, Germany. With meetergo you can use alfaview as a meeting location, so every booking gets its own time-boxed alfaview meeting and a join link for your guest.
alfaview always needs a connection. Meetings are created through the alfaview API with your company's API key. There is no anonymous mode.
What you'll need
You need an alfaview account with admin access to your company's administration interface, and a plan that includes API access. Then create an API key:
- Log in to the alfaview administration interface.
- Click Company in the menu on the left.
- Open the API keys tab.
- Enter a name in the Alias field and click Create.
Save the three values shown: the account ID, the alias, and the code (the API key itself).
Connecting in meetergo
- In meetergo, go to Integrations & Apps.
- Find alfaview and click on it.
- Fill in the account ID, alias, and API key, then click Connect.
meetergo checks the credentials against the alfaview API. Once connected, you'll see a green "Connected" status.
Using alfaview in your meeting types
- Go to Meeting Types and open the meeting type you want to configure.
- In the Venue section, select alfaview.
- Save your changes.
When someone books this meeting type, meetergo creates an alfaview meeting at the booked time and adds the participant join link to the confirmation. Attendees join straight from the link in their browser or the alfaview app, no alfaview account required.
If you move or cancel a booking in meetergo, the alfaview meeting is updated or cancelled too.
FAQ
Where do I find my API credentials?
In the alfaview administration interface under Company > API keys. See the alfaview guide on API credentials.
The API keys tab is missing
API access depends on your alfaview plan. Ask alfaview support if you can't see the tab.
Do attendees need an alfaview account?
No. Each booking gets a join link that attendees open without an account.
Is the connection per user or per company?
Per user. Each team member who hosts alfaview meetings connects their own alfaview company's API key.
